ARKADELPHIA, Ark. – Saturday afternoon marked a historic first in the storied history of Henderson State women's volleyball as they earned their first conference win as a member of the Great American Conference with a three-set sweep over Northwestern Oklahoma State University.
The Lady Reddies (5-16, 1-7 GAC) enjoyed one of their best offensive performances of the season as they totaled a season-high 40 kills for a three-set match against NWOSU. HSU also totaled double-digit kills in each of the three sets for the third time this season; all Henderson wins.
Leading the offensive charge for the Lady Reddies was sophomore middle blocker
Jessica Moss. The Garland, Texas native hammered home a team-high 14 kills on 19 attacks and did not commit an attack error as she turned in an attack percentage of .737. The error-less attack effort by Moss was the second of her season, with the first coming the Lady Reddies' opening match of the year, also a Henderson win.
Ty Lindberg and
Sarah Williams joined Moss in double-digit kills as each recorded an even 10 kills. Williams committed just one error on 22 total attacks for an attack percentage of .409.
Malorie Kelly and
Lauren Ray paced the defense off of the Lady Rangers' (1-19, 0-8 GAC) attacks as Kelly netted 12 digs and Ray finished with 10 digs. Five different Lady Reddies registered block assists in the win with Williams leading the team with her three block assists. Moss, Lindberg, and
Cheyenne Derr each added two block assists.
Newcomer
Emily Belz dished out a match-high 35 assists. It is the third time this season that Belz has reached that total for assists.
